Responsibilities Assist attorneys with maritime and civil litigation cases by organizing and managing case files. Handling filings and service documents (both outgoing and incoming), calendaring, and maintaining case information/materials within our online system (iManage). Assistance with drafting/editing/proofreading of pleadings and discovery, ensuring accuracy/compliance with court procedures and utilization of appropriate formatting, spelling, punctuation, and grammar. Responsible for scheduling depositions, preparing related notices, and communicating with court reporting services, videographers, and interpreters. Working with our lawyers and accounting department to assist with the handling of vendor invoices, expense reports, client billing, and attorney time entries (Aderant timekeeper software). Support litigation efforts by preparing trial/hearing and written discovery/document production materials. Utilize legal research tools/online databases such as Westlaw, Texas Secretary of State, PACER/ECF, and local Texas state court e-filing systems/online dockets to support case handling. Maintaining/updating online calendars (e.g., hearings, depositions, mediations, trials, meetings, deadlines, etc.) for assigned attorneys. Communications with clients regarding scheduling, billing, and other administrative matters. Transcription of documents/correspondence from audio-recorded dictation. Submitting conflicts checks and assisting with opening of new files. Required Skills Ability to effectively present information verbally and in writing.
